One of the side results of being a creative person is that you are always making new ‘things’. As I produce new pieces of art, not only do I have more examples of my abilities, my supplies accumulate and the space needed to store my supplies increases. As other friends stop different creative pursuits, I tend to inherit their crafting left-overs. I don’t mind! However; it does cause some “Now what am I going to do with that stuff?” types of thoughts.
Being a teacher for preschool and kindergarten has also caused a knack to see potential in everything. Do you have any idea what a toilet paper roll can be transformed into? This can be problematic to a creative-collector. I have always thought I would like to be an artist-in-residence, so I have kept boxes of potential project supplies for my future endeavors. I can see all of these pieces of art in my mind, and every time I go to par-down, I am only reminded of the ‘things’ I had planned to make.
The time is now!! As my art career becomes my focus, I have to start using the materials I have been saving. Like the supplies I have in abundance, I have an abundance of memories and stories to go with the ‘who’ and ‘where’ the foundational items came from. I also have an abundant quantity of ideas yet to come to fruition.
Creativity and inspiration in profusion + an ample amount of supplies = Expressions of Abundance.
